The recommended power-up sequence is to apply the analog power supplies (AVDD and AVSS) first, followed by the digital power supplies (DVDD and DVSS). This ensures that the analog circuitry is powered up before the digital circuitry.
To optimize the performance of the AD9235, it is recommended to use a low-noise power supply, decouple the power supplies with capacitors, and use a low-impedance analog input source. Additionally, the analog input signal should be properly filtered and terminated to minimize noise and distortion.
The maximum clock frequency that can be used with the AD9235 is 40 MHz. However, the actual clock frequency used may be limited by the specific application and the performance requirements.
The AD9235 can be interfaced with a microcontroller or FPGA using a serial peripheral interface (SPI) or a parallel interface. The specific interface used will depend on the requirements of the application and the capabilities of the microcontroller or FPGA.
The latency of the AD9235 is approximately 10 clock cycles, which corresponds to a latency of around 250 ns at a clock frequency of 40 MHz. This latency should be taken into account when designing the overall system, as it can affect the timing and synchronization of the data conversion process.
